Experience John Holly's Asian Bistro
Contributed by: Jeffrey Schwartz on 9/13/2006

John Holly's Asian Bistro
9232 Park Meadows Drive
Lone Tree, CO 80124
303-768-9088

Grade: A

Good Asian restaurants can be difficult to find. You can visit a chain, such as P.F. Changs or Pei Wei, but the problem with chains is that the food and atmosphere loses authenticity. Moreover, those chains can be a bit on the pricey side.

Last year, my wife and I discovered John Holly's Asian Bistro. We wanted something different, and have been in a rather desperate search to find a good, affordable Asian restaurant on the south side of town. We've been very happy, repeat customers ever since.

An impressive introduction to John Holly's would be to visit during lunch. Honestly, you're provided with a lunch menu that just can't be beat. Prices start at $5.95 and include soup, an egg roll and your main course. The main course has never appeared to be scaled down from dinner-sized to lunch-sized. There is also a lunch combination plate selection made up of sushi assortments ranging in price from $7.95 to $11.95.

If you don't have the time for lunch, dinner would be a great option. Unlike the lunch menu, however, soup and appetizers are a la carte. The prices are only slightly higher on the dinner menu than they are on the lunch menu.

Sushi and sashimi are always available, and the restaurant has its own sushi bar just outside of the dining area. There is a standard sushi menu as well as a non-standard menu that changes as new items are brought in. While sushi isn't normally inexpensive, John Holly's offers an affordable sushi menu with absolutely fresh ingredients.

One of the great things about John Holly's is the fact that you're not limited to what's on the menu. If you have a favorite Asian dish that you don't see on the menu, all you have to do is speak to your server, and the kitchen is more than happy to accommodate your request. Try doing that at a chain restaurant, and you'll only hear excuses if the change isn't easy.

Service isn't rushed by any means. While the restaurant is usually crowded, the staff does not make an effort to push you out the door in an attempt to seat more diners. Instead, the staff allows you to enjoy your meal and eat at whatever speed you deem as appropriate. I have always found the staff to be helpful, friendly, well-informed and attentive.

The restaurant does offer take-out as well as a free delivery service within a five-mile radius and a minimum order of $10.00. You can view the menu at http://www.ufeedme.com/johnholly.

The ambiance of the restaurant is above average compared to most Asian restaurants. Many independent restaurants attempt to have Asian trinkets hanging from the walls and ceilings in an effort to lend credibility. The chains tend to spend vast sums on décor. With John Holly's you'll find neither. Instead, you'll be treated to a clean, modern dining area that is both inviting and comfortable.

If you're looking for a high-quality Asian restaurant that won't break the bank, will provide you with top-notch service and excellent food, then I'll invite you to visit John Holly's Asian Bistro. This is one of my favorite restaurants in the Denver area, and I believe it will become one of yours, too.
